Abstract

A management system is for a parking site for vehicles with at least one parking zone including a plurality of parking places. The system includes an output device for data carriers that are to be carried by users of the site and equipment for reading and/or writing information on the data carriers, the output device and the read/write equipment being connected to a data processing centre. The read/write equipment interacts with passing data carriers within a specific remote action area, in such a way that data can be wirelessly transmitted in passing, thus allowing the displacement, the parking zone used and optionally even the occupied parking space to be tracked and the data to be made available in a centralized manner in the data processing centre and also in a decentralized manner on the data carrier of each individual user.

Claims (9)

  1. Management system for a vehicle car park which has at least one parking zone with a plurality of parking spaces, having an issuing device for data carriers which are to be carried by users of the car park and having devices for reading the data carriers, the issuing device and the reading devices being connected to a data processing centre, and the reading devices interacting with passing data carriers within a specific telecontrol range (30) in such a way that data can be transmitted in a wire-free fashion when a data carrier (10) passes, characterized in that the devices for reading are also designed to write to the data carriers, and the issuing device is designed to issue, as a pair, a first data carrier (10) which is to be carried by the user and a second data carrier (10') which is assigned to said data carrier (10) and is provided to stay in the parked vehicle, and in that a monitoring device which is connected to the data processing centre is embodied in such a way that an exit from the car park is not cleared until after the parking fee has been paid and after the pair of data carriers (10, 10') which are assigned to one another have been returned.
  2. Management system according to Claim 1, characterized in that a monitoring device is provided which triggers the photographing of the vehicle or user located at the monitoring device and/or triggers an alarm signal if the second data carrier (10') is not returned or if a second data carrier (10') which is not assigned to the first data carrier (10) is returned.
  3. Management system according to Claim 1 or 2, characterized in that a data carrier (10) has a transceiver device (11, 16) for transmitting data by means of electromagnetic radiation, a microprocessor (12) for processing the transmitted data and storage means (13, 14, 15) for the transmitted data.
  4. Management system according to one of Claims 1 to 3, characterized in that user data can be written by the issuing device to a data carrier (10, 10') which is to be issued.
  5. Management system according to one of Claims 1 to 4, characterized in that read/write devices (20) are arranged in the region of an entrance and/or exit of a parking zone so that when the data carrier (10) which is carried by the user passes on the way to a parking space, the respective read/write device (20) and the passing data carrier (10) can register this and pass it on to the data processing centre.
  6. Management system according to one of Claims 1 to 5, characterized in that read/write devices (20) are arranged in a parking zone or at a parking space so that, after a parking space has been occupied, the presence of the data carrier which is carried by the user can be registered by the respective read/write device (20) and by the data carrier (10) which is present and can be passed on to the data processing centre, the read/write devices (20) having means for confirming that registration has taken place.
  7. Management system according to one of Claims 1 to 6, characterized in that reading devices (20) with a display device are arranged in a parking zone, and information - stored on a data carrier (10) - about the used parking zone or the occupied parking space can be output and displayed by means of said display device.
  8. Management system according to one of Claims 1 to 7, characterized in that a payment device are provided for paying parking fees by means of the data carrier (10), which payment device comprises means for playing back the position of the used parking zone or of the occupied parking space in the car park.
  9. Management system according to Claim 8, characterized in that light signal means which can be activated after the parking fee for a parking space has been paid are installed at said parking space.
